Best time to visit
Early morning at opening to avoid crowds and enjoy cool, soft light through the eastern stained glass; late afternoon works for warm tones on the western windows but expect more visitors.
Budget tips
Standard adult tickets usually cost around €26–35, tower access adds about €8–12, so buy timed-entry tickets online well in advance to avoid long lines. Free entry is not generally available to tourists, though some city tourist passes include Sagrada Familia access so compare pass prices before purchasing.

About
Rychlá fakta: Uvnitř katedrály se sloupy rozvětvují jako kmeny stromů, světlo z vitráží maluje na podlahu duhové vzory a vytváří dojem kamenného lesa. Plán počítá s 18 věžemi, které mají symbolizovat apoštoly, evangelisty a další biblické postavy.
Hlavní zajímavosti: Antoni Gaudí je pochován v kryptě, a během občanské války v roce 1936 byly zničeny většiny jeho sádrových modelů, takže současní stavitelé museli rekonstruovat stovky drobných detailů podle dochovaných fotografií a poznámek. Uvnitř tě obklopí stovky barevných vitráží, které dopoledne rozlévají zlatavé a hřejivé tóny a odpoledne převládají chladné modré a zelené, přičemž hlavní věž má být vysoká přibližně 172,5 metru a fasády nesou názvy Narození, Utrpení a Slávy.
Insider tips
- Book the first entry slot of the day to see the nave with fewer people and softer light.
- Wear comfortable shoes and dress respectfully, shoulders covered if you plan to visit the crypt or attend a service.
- Head up a tower only if comfortable with narrow stairs and heights, otherwise skip the tower and spend extra time inside.
- Photograph the interior from near the central nave columns for dramatic symmetry, and capture the Nativity façade in the morning for cleaner light.
